United States

this exact occupation · BLS 2025
  • $104,000 a year — the middle: half earn more, half earn less
  • The lowest tenth earn near $53,750; the top tenth near $201,550
  • 113,330 people employed in this occupation

India

the occupation GROUP, not this job · PLFS via ILOSTAT 2025
  • ₹38,298 a month — the median for Professionals, the group this work sits in
  • India publishes pay by broad occupation group, so this covers many jobs besides this one. It is a shape, not a salary.
read this carefullyThese two numbers are not comparable and must not be converted into each other. One is a yearly figure for this job alone; the other is a monthly figure for a whole family of jobs. What travels between them is the pattern, not the amount: experience lifts pay almost everywhere.

You’ll split time between design work and technical tasks. Mornings often include meetings with clients or product teams to align the site with business goals and review timelines or moodboards.

Afternoons are for hands-on work: creating page layouts in Adobe Photoshop or Illustrator, building prototypes, writing HTML/CSS/JavaScript, testing pages across browsers and devices, and updating site content. You’ll also check site performance and traffic and fix bugs as they appear.

Start with Adobe Photoshop and Illustrator for visuals, and Adobe InDesign or After Effects if you make layouts or motion graphics. For code, learn HTML, JavaScript, and basic SQL.

For hosting and backend work, learn Amazon Web Services basics (EC2, DynamoDB, Redshift if you touch data). Familiarize yourself with AJAX for dynamic pages and simple server performance logging (server load, bandwidth).

Use AI for speed—generate layout ideas, alt text, or draft copy—but never paste sensitive client data into public tools. Treat AI output like a first draft: verify accuracy, accessibility, and copyright.

Keep records of what you used AI for in project notes, and ask clients for permission if AI will touch proprietary content. Run AI-generated images or code through your usual QA, accessibility checks, and performance tests.

You’ll write HTML, JavaScript, and sometimes SQL regularly—for page structure, interactivity, and simple database queries. Expect to fix integration issues, test AJAX calls, and optimize assets.

You don’t need to be a full-stack developer, but you should be comfortable editing code, reading system interaction diagrams, and using dev tools to troubleshoot browser or server reports (load, device types, bandwidth).

According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) for 2025, there were 113,330 employed web designers with a median wage of $104,000 per year. The lowest tenth earned $53,750 and the top tenth earned $201,550 per year.

Local pay varies by city, experience, portfolio strength, and whether you add related skills like front-end development or AWS. Use the BLS data as a national benchmark.

A web designer focuses on visual layout, content updates, and integrating multimedia—using tools like Photoshop and InDesign—while keeping the site aligned with business goals.

A UX designer specializes in user research, journey maps, and usability testing. A front-end developer builds interactive functionality and optimizes performance with deeper JavaScript, frameworks, and server integration. Web designers sit between these roles and often do tasks from both areas.

Build a strong portfolio with 3–6 real pages: show layout design (Photoshop/Illustrator), a working HTML/CSS/JavaScript page, and examples of content updates and troubleshooting you did.

Also learn to run simple site tests, document results, and explain performance metrics (server load, bandwidth, browser types). Employers look for practical work you can talk through, not just certificates.
